Bimboinviaggio.com features a collection of more than 250
family friendly hotels and over 80 parks and museums. The website is enriched
by articles written by journalists and reporters suggesting the best family
friendly activities and places to visit.
In 2010 Bimboinviaggio.com was approved by Ordine dei
Giornalisti (the Journalists’ Council) as online magazine to underline the
quality of this medium, thus strengthening the loyalty of those families
looking for reliable partners in planning their holidays.
